Key Responsibilities
Lead development of next-generation solid rocket motor systems with direct impact on defense and aerospace capabilities
Drive innovation in propellant formulation and manufacturing processes affecting product performance and safety
Conduct critical analysis of rocket motor ballistics and structural integrity impacting mission success
Spearhead testing and qualification processes ensuring product reliability and safety standards
Implement and evaluate cutting-edge technologies advancing manufacturing capabilities
Own end-to-end design and troubleshooting processes across multiple technology areas
